WebMar 23, 2001 · A regulatory loop between the fibroblast growth factors FGF-8 and FGF-10 plays a key role in limb initiation and AER induction in vertebrate embryos. Here, we show that three WNT factors signaling through β-catenin act as key regulators of the FGF-8/FGF-10 loop. WebSep 6, 2024 · The Wnt-FGF gradient is a paradigm which has been very well established in the context of development. It plays an extensive role during axis formation in development (Dyer et al., 2014; Oginuma et al., 2024).
